Rabbit Qualities
Rabbit fur felts offer a versatile solution, combining good performance, consistency, and cost efficiency, making it suitable for a wide range of applications.
Different classifications (BB, EB, MC, X levels) reflect variations in fiber selection and processing, influencing the final appearance and behavior of the felt.
-
Standard qualities (BB, EB, MC)
- Designed for dress and millinery applications
- Reliable and consistent performance
- Different fiber selections:
- BB – lower grade fur
- EB – medium grade fur
- MC – higher grade fur
-
X qualities (2X – 5X)
- Developed for western applications, requiring higher structure and durability
- Improved refinement and surface quality
- Fiber grading within the range:
- 2X – lower grade fur
- 3X – 4X – medium grade fur
- 5X – higher grade fur
-
LLX (Hare fur)
- Finer fiber structure with natural sheen
- Particularly suitable for velour and melusine finishes
- Selected for its brightness and premium appearance
- Positioned for higher-end applications
Qualities that include Rabbit ou Hare in the composition:
| QUALITY | COMPOSITION |
|---|---|
| BB | 100% Rabbit Fur |
| EB | 100% Rabbit Fur |
| MC | 100% Rabbit Fur |
| 2X | 100% Rabbit Fur |
| 4X | 100% Rabbit Fur |
| 5X | 100% Rabbit Fur |
| LLX | 100% Hare Fur |
| 50LLX | 50% Hare Fur + 50% Rabbit Fur |
